St. Pete restaurants sharing staff as hurricane recovery continues
St. Petersburg restaurants are taking a united stand in sharing staff as they work towards recovery from Hurricanes Helene and Milton. The hospitality industry in Pinellas County is facing significant challenges, but many local servers express their gratitude for the opportunity to remain employed.
